[0020] Refer now Figure 4-7 , The rear view of the example mobile communication device 10 is described in different exploded states. The RF test access port 50 is shown to be located at the rear of the mobile communication device 10, near the antenna 52. In this embodiment, the antenna 52 is located at the bottom of the device. By locating the antenna at the bottom of the device, the antenna 52 is located near the battery box 54 and the battery box cover 56 is designed so that the antenna is located under the battery cover. The battery cover 56 is used to cover the access port 50. Since the cover 56 covers the access port 50, a separate plug is not required to close the port 50.

[0021] Figure 4 The rear housing 58 of the mobile communication device 10 is shown, where the speaker 60 and the speaker cover 62 are located on the top of the device, and the battery cover 56 is located under the speaker cover 62. Abstract

A housing (26) for a mobile communication device (10) includes a housing member (58) that encloses the mobile communication device (10). An opening (54) is positioned in the housing member (58) for accepting a battery (68). A door (56) is positioned over the opening (54) in the housing member (58), with an access port (50) defined through the housing member positioned under the door (56) for contacting an internal element (52) of a mobile communication device (10), such as an antenna (52). A method for testing an antenna (52) in a mobile communication device (10) having a housing (26) with an antenna access port (50) defined therethrough, an antenna (52), a battery compartment (54), and a removable cover positioned over at least part of the housing (26) is also described.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a test access port for testing antennas in mobile communication devices. Background technique [0002] A mobile communication device includes an antenna for communicating with a wireless network. Before the mobile communication equipment leaves the factory, the antenna must be tested to ensure the correct installation and working status of the antenna. [0003] There are many different methods for testing mobile communication devices during assembly. One method is to do a two-part test, where first the board and antenna are tested, and then the second and final test checks the entire device. When using a two-part test, typically the housing of the equipment is installed after the first test is performed so that the antenna can be accessed.
